## Deployment

Inkpress renders PDF invoices from templates your plugin supplies. Deploy as a single container behind the Ledgerline gateway. Plugins load at startup only; restart after every plugin change. Memory scales with page count — budget 256 MB per concurrent render. Health endpoint returns 200 once font caches warm, typically 40 seconds. Do not ship fonts inside plugins; register them via the manifest instead. Your plugin inherits the host defaults, which are currently set as follows.

service settings:
PRAIX_LOG_LEVEL=error
PRAIX_METRICS_HOST=metrics.praix.qorvelcorp.corp
PRAIX_POOL_SIZE=16

## Configuration

Paylatch generates idempotency keys for every payment retry, ensuring duplicate submissions from your plugin are collapsed server-side. Plugin authors must set PAYLATCH_RETRY_MAX and PAYLATCH_KEY_TTL in their .env to control retry behavior. Key generation is HMAC-based, so the gateway requires a shared secret to validate keys your plugin emits. Add the following line to your environment file:

secret setting of bagag-fafof: LEDGER_TOKEN29=2087e95a7be258fc3f2cc54ea20c7

**Vendor note: Inkmill markdown pipeline**

Rendering for Parchway docs is outsourced to Inkmill under an annual contract, renewing each March. They handle sanitization and PDF export; we own the upload queue. SLA: 4-hour response on rendering failures. Escalate only after two failed retries. Their support desk is reachable at the address below.

billing contact of hahaf-baguf = zorael.tammir.jorius@sivrelhq.internal

## Step 4: Stabilize integration tests against Ledgerline

Plugin authors upgrading to Ledgerline 3.x should expect intermittent failures in the payments integration suite if retries are left at legacy defaults. The flakiness stems from the new asynchronous settlement queue, which can return a pending state for up to two seconds after capture. Configure your test harness to poll the settlement endpoint rather than asserting on the first response. Before running the suite, set the following values in your local overrides.

deployment values, bagaf-kagag:
istael:
  pin: 2777
  tenant: tamvan
  seal: seal_75cefd5e
  metrics_host: metrics.istael.qirvanio.example
  standby_team: holion
  escalation: kelmir-drudor
  nonce: d13cd7